The Food Bank
The Windsor Food Bank provides supplemental food for low income Windsor residents. It is located at the L.P. Wilson Community center and is stocked with dry and canned goods as well as fresh fruits and vegetables and frozen meat.
Currently there are 461 registered households. The Food Bank is coordinated by Windsor Social Services and is staffed by Social Services staff and an amazing group of volunteers. To qualify to use the Food Bank you must be Windsor resident and meet certain financial eligibility guidelines. Please visit the Social Services website to view the application. Applications must be submitted in person at the Food Bank or at the Social Services department.
The Food Bank is open 9 am to 11:15 am Monday and Tuesday and 1:00 pm to 3:15pm Wednesday and Thursday. During a typical month, it is visited by over 220 residents.
The Food Bank is made possible through many community-based food drives and donations to the Windsor Community Service Council. With monetary donations, we are able to obtain food in bulk from FoodShare of Greater Hartford at a greatly reduced cost.
